Is work experience required for NVQ Diploma in Human Resource Management part time?

When it comes to pursuing an NVQ Diploma in Human Resource Management part time, many individuals wonder whether work experience is a prerequisite for enrolling in the program. The answer to this question can vary depending on the specific institution offering the course, but in general, having some level of work experience in the field of human resources can be beneficial.

While some institutions may not explicitly require work experience for entry into the NVQ Diploma program, having practical experience in the field can greatly enhance your understanding of the concepts taught in the course. Human resource management is a field that requires a combination of theoretical knowledge and practical skills, and having work experience can help you apply what you learn in real-world scenarios.

Additionally, many employers value candidates who have hands-on experience in human resources, as it demonstrates that you have the skills and knowledge needed to succeed in the field. By gaining work experience while pursuing your NVQ Diploma, you can make yourself a more attractive candidate to potential employers upon graduation.

That being said, if you do not have any prior work experience in human resources, it does not necessarily mean that you cannot enroll in an NVQ Diploma program. Many institutions offer introductory courses that can provide you with the foundational knowledge needed to succeed in the field, even if you do not have prior experience.

Ultimately, whether or not work experience is required for an NVQ Diploma in Human Resource Management part time will depend on the specific requirements of the institution offering the program. It is always a good idea to check with the institution directly to determine their specific admissions criteria and whether work experience is necessary for enrollment.
